What does a Manager M365 Administrator do?

A Manager M365 Administrator oversees the administration and management of Microsoft 365 (M365) services within an organization. This role involves configuring, maintaining, and optimizing M365 applications such as Exchange Online, SharePoint, Teams, and OneDrive. In addition to technical responsibilities, the manager leads a team of administrators, sets best practices for security and compliance, and ensures smooth user adoption and support. They also collaborate with other IT leaders to align M365 services with business goals.

What is the difference between Manager M365 Administrator vs Microsoft 365 Support Specialist?

AspectManager M365 AdministratorMicrosoft 365 Support Specialist
Primary RoleOversees M365 environment management, strategy, and team leadershipProvides technical support and troubleshooting for Microsoft 365 users
CertificationsMicrosoft 365 Certified: Enterprise Administrator Expert, Microsoft 365 Certified: Modern Desktop AdministratorMicrosoft 365 Certified: Fundamentals or Modern Desktop Administrator
Work EnvironmentTeam management, strategic planning, system configurationHelpdesk, technical support, user assistance
Employer UsageLarge organizations, IT departments, enterprise environmentsIT support teams, service desks, smaller to mid-sized companies

The Manager M365 Administrator focuses on managing and strategizing the Microsoft 365 environment, leading teams, and ensuring system optimization. In contrast, the Microsoft 365 Support Specialist primarily handles user support, troubleshooting, and resolving technical issues. Both roles require relevant certifications, but their responsibilities and work settings differ significantly.

Job description

Role Summary

The Service Engineer II independently resolves more complex issues and assumes full ownership for end-to-end resolution. This role requires stronger technical judgment, efficiency, proactive communication, and disciplined execution in a metric-driven environment. This role may include dedicated client service assignments requiring broad technical execution, independent ownership, and cross-functional collaboration within Executech standards.

Only Local candidates will be considered

Key Responsibilities
  • Resolve issues beyond Service Engineer I scope across devices, identity, Microsoft 365, networking fundamentals, and core business systems, acting as a consistent technical lead for assigned clients and queues.
  • Own tickets end-to-end: client updates, vendor/carrier coordination, resolution confirmation, and handoff when scope spans multiple teams.
  • Apply structured troubleshooting and sound judgment on when to proceed independently, escalate, or engage additional resources.
  • Use scripting and automation for repeatable tasks (e.g., PowerShell for standard admin actions) within approved standards.
  • Support security posture through correct identity verification, suspicious-activity handling, and incident escalation workflows.
  • Contribute to operational improvement: surface recurring issues, recommend remediation, and update KB/runbooks.
  • Mentor Service Engineer I staff through shadowing, pairing, and high-quality escalation feedback.
  • Balance client advocacy with scalability, security, and Executech standards, operating across functional boundaries when needed while adhering to change control, documentation, and escalation practices.
Typical Work Scope (Examples)
  • Multi-step M365 administration (licenses, groups, mailbox permissions, SharePoint/Teams access issues) with judgment and minimal supervision.
  • Endpoint and device management (Intune policies, device compliance basics, BitLocker recovery, Autopilot resets) within SOP.
  • Identity and access management troubleshooting (Conditional Access impacts, SSO issues, MFA/Authenticator edge cases).
  • Backup/DR and security tooling triage (agent health, failed jobs, initial containment actions per incident SOP).
  • PSA/RMM improvements: suggests workflow fixes; flags recurring issue trends with evidence.
Performance Expectations (KPIs)
  • SLA compliance: ≥ 90% (rolling 90-day).
  • CSAT: ≥ 97% positive (rolling 90-day).
  • Utilization: 90% utilization target.
  • Billable efficiency: ≥ 80% billable efficiency (rolling 90-day).
  • Ticket quality: meets documentation/time-entry standards; participates in QA audits.
  • QA target: ≥ 90/100 (< 85/100 triggers coaching plan).
Skills & Experience
  • 2–5 years of IT support experience with increasing complexity (MSP experience strongly preferred).
  • Strong working knowledge of Microsoft 365 administration, identity, device management, and common MSP toolsets.
  • Able to prioritize effectively under SLA pressure while maintaining quality and client communication.
  • Comfortable performing intermediate troubleshooting across multiple systems and documenting evidence.
  • Working knowledge of PowerShell fundamentals and willingness to build safe automation (reviewed/approved).
Certification Expectations
  • Hold (or actively pursue) one Microsoft role-based certification aligned to daily responsibilities (e.g., MD-102 or MS-102).
  • AZ-104 is recommended for engineers working regularly in Azure/M365 administration and is required for Senior promotion readiness.
